Job Description

The Occupational Health Client Services Coordinator serves as the main resource of support based on experience, and ability to facilitate client needs through exclusive knowledge of program. Provide support to Senior Account Manager by serving as liaison between clients, staff, and other providers. Assist clients, carriers, TPAs, legal representatives, and others by insuring time-sensitive requests to Medical Director are addressed.


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  1. Coordinate verbal and written requests as directed by Medical Director.
  2. Insure Medical Director is aware of potential and existing customer service matters as needed; to avoid be unprepared.
  3. Facilitate non-medical appointments, reminder updates, and duties as directed by Medical Director or Sr. Account Manager.
  4. Assist with requests both internally and externally.
  5. Coordinate scheduling for occupational health clients, case managers, and others with Medical Director or manager.
  6. Devise forms for department and update existing forms in use.
  7. Assist department manager with networking events by updating client database, preparing marketing packets, written correspondence, and surveys.
  8. Weekly monitor list of targeted businesses to market services using WCNP visits data, referrals, and other sales leads.
  9. Update clients regarding Occupational Health service lines.
  10. Collaborate with department manager to expand client base and improve services.
  11. Oversee client protocols and assist employer service coordinator as needed.
  12. Merge random program employer lists and generate notification letters.
  13. Prepare and organize employer health-fair agendas and materials.
  14. Assist with quotes and proposals for services as directed by manager.
  15. Maintain database of targeted businesses to market services.
  16. Collaborate with other departments as needed.
  17. Coordinate requests to assist in improvement and expansion to program.
  18. Track patient/client satisfaction through client service calls/surveys and resolving service matters.

Qualifications

EDUCATION: High School graduate or equivalent.

EXPERIENCE: 

  • 1-5 years’ experience in Occupational Healthcare setting.
  • Experience with eCW is preferred

POSITION REQUIRMENTS:

  • Works independently and has ability to prioritize tasks.
  • Proficient in decision-making and ability to adapt to changing trends.
  • Maintain a high degree of competency and quality with regard to reports, forms, and written communication.
  • Thorough knowledge of medical and Occupational Health terminology.
  • Possesses understanding of corporate goals and structure.
  • Contributes to the success and growth of physician practice.
